Just in the last few months, here are some of the more notable accomplishments that the agency has achieved to better serve the needs of the public and our license holders.  First, the agency formally rescinded a standing policy that it would work closely with the Texas Facilities Commission to explore the potential to build an office building in the Capitol Complex.  The agency determined that a portion of the funds previously allocated for a potential building project would be best used to directly underwrite the growing costs associated with addressing more broadly - and even more quickly - our efforts to find better solutions to the customer service challenges we were experiencing while serving our expanding base of license holders and the continued Texas population growth. Additional alternative uses for such funds will also be explored. 

We further refined the “call tree” and “call-back” features of our phone system to track and handle Commission and Board calls separately. To better service our license holders, we also created three new no-cost online tools. In November we went live with an online a license history certificate, which is available to all TREC license holders. Over the last two months, we implemented a new application processing progress tracker and a tool to display of all education taken and required to renew a license. Currently, these tools are targeted to our largest group of real estate license holders and applicants but will be expanded to provide these services to all of our license holders in the near future. These three new services have further reduced the need for stakeholders to contact the agency regarding these matters. Together with enhanced staffing and phone system programming, recent average call hold times are under five minutes. Our goal is to keep them this low and to improve even further, while also expanding these tools to serve more license types, including appraisers.  Stay tuned…    

Also in the last year, we’ve added seven additional staff to the customer contact center, three to the licensing area, two to education and three more to enforcement services for appraisers.  These major enhancements were only possible because of the flexibility provided by our SDSI status.
